Factors that affect the length of alcohol detox: Amount of alcohol consumed on a daily basis Frequency of alcohol intake Length of time the patient was abusing alcohol Patient’s weight, age, and overall nutrition Co-occurring mental health disorders Whether other substances were being used with alcohol Alcohol withdrawal symptoms usually begin within eight hours of the last drink, and peak at between 24 and 72 hours after the last drink. According to the NIAAA, “Patients for whom outpatient detoxification is not appropriate become candidates for inpatient detoxification.” Outpatient detox is more suited for those with fewer difficulties and issues that are either results of or exacerbated by their drug use. The problem with detox kits or attempting detox alone is that the person may not be aware of underlying mental health issues, medical problems or complications as they occur. If a medical problem comes up, someone detoxing at home does not have the training or education to recognize a complication and they could be in an unsafe situation without any help.
